Key Differences

TDP
Radeon RX 7600:165W
ASRock Intel Arc B580 Challenger 12GB:190W

What this means: TDP indicates the thermal output and power draw. Higher TDP means you need a beefier power supply and better case airflow. Lower TDP cards run cooler and quieter, making them easier to fit into compact builds without thermal throttling.

VRAM
Radeon RX 7600:8GB
ASRock Intel Arc B580 Challenger 12GB:12GB

What this means: More VRAM lets you run higher-resolution textures and handle complex scenes without stuttering. Critical for 4K gaming and content creation. Cards with 12GB+ handle modern AAA titles at 4K comfortably; 8GB may struggle with ultra textures in the latest games.

Boost Clock
Radeon RX 7600:2,655 MHz
ASRock Intel Arc B580 Challenger 12GB:2,670 MHz

What this means: Boost clock is the card's advertised peak GPU frequency under favorable power and thermal conditions. It is useful when comparing closely related GPU designs, but a smaller GPU with a higher clock can still be much slower than a larger GPU with more compute units, cache, VRAM, and bandwidth.

Memory Bandwidth
Radeon RX 7600:288 GB/s
ASRock Intel Arc B580 Challenger 12GB:456 GB/s

What this means: Memory bandwidth is the rate at which the GPU can move data between the graphics processor and VRAM. Higher bandwidth can help at higher resolutions, with large textures, and in memory-heavy workloads.
